【怎么设置开机启动项】在日常使用电脑的过程中,用户常常会遇到需要调整开机启动项的问题。开机启动项是指系统启动时自动运行的程序或服务,合理设置可以提升系统启动速度、优化资源占用,并确保关键程序正常运行。本文将总结如何在不同操作系统中设置开机启动项,并提供表格形式的对比说明。
一、Windows 系统设置开机启动项
在 Windows 中,可以通过“任务管理器”或“系统配置工具”来管理开机启动项。以下是具体步骤:
1. 通过任务管理器
- 按下 `Ctrl + Shift + Esc` 打开任务管理器。
- 切换到“启动”选项卡。
- 右键点击不需要的程序,选择“禁用”。
2. 通过系统配置工具(msconfig)
- 按下 `Win + R`,输入 `msconfig`,回车。
- 切换到“启动”选项卡,取消勾选不需要的程序。
- 点击“应用”并重启电脑。
3. 通过注册表编辑器(高级用户)
- 按下 `Win + R`,输入 `regedit`,回车。
- 导航至 `H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Run`。
- 删除或修改不需要的启动项。
二、macOS 系统设置开机启动项
在 macOS 中,可以通过“系统偏好设置”中的“用户与群组”来管理开机启动项:
1. 打开“系统偏好设置” → “用户与群组”。
2. 选择当前用户账户,点击“登录项”标签。
3. 选择不需要的应用程序,点击“-”号移除。
此外,也可以通过终端命令进行高级管理,例如使用 `launchctl` 命令添加或删除启动项。
三、Linux 系统设置开机启动项
在 Linux 系统中,开机启动项通常由 `systemd` 或 `init.d` 控制,具体方法因发行版而异:
1. 使用 systemd
- 查看当前启动项:`systemctl list-unit-files --type=service`
- 启用服务:`sudo systemctl enable service_name`
- 禁用服务:`sudo systemctl disable service_name`
2. 使用 init.d 脚本(旧版本)
- 将脚本放入 `/etc/init.d/` 目录。
- 使用 `update-rc.d` 添加启动项:`sudo update-rc.d service_name defaults`
四、常见问题与注意事项
- 避免过多启动项:过多的启动项会拖慢系统启动速度,影响性能。
- 定期检查:建议定期清理不必要的启动项,保持系统流畅。
- 权限问题:部分系统设置可能需要管理员权限才能更改。
五、各系统开机启动项设置方式对比表
操作系统 | 设置方式 | 工具名称 | 是否需要管理员权限 | 备注 |
Windows | 任务管理器 / msconfig | 任务管理器 / msconfig | 否(部分功能需管理员) | 推荐使用任务管理器操作简单 |
macOS | 系统偏好设置 | 用户与群组 | 否 | 仅支持图形界面操作 |
Linux | systemd / init.d | systemctl / init.d | 是(多数情况) | 不同发行版略有差异 |
总结
设置开机启动项是优化系统性能的重要手段之一。无论是 Windows、macOS 还是 Linux,都有相应的工具和方法来进行管理。用户应根据自身需求,合理配置启动项,以提升使用体验。同时,注意不要随意关闭关键系统服务,以免影响系统稳定性。